当前位置: 首页 > 图文教程 > 网页制作 > CSS样式表 > IE6支持position:fixed完美解决方法

CSS样式表
CSS垂直居中网页布局实现的5种方法
CSS实现绝对的完美圆角框
WebKit中可用的CSS高级特性
css框架(CSS Frameworks):CSS框架应用
针对不同版本的IE浏览器的条件CSS应用
CSS代码优化7个准则
CSS实例:创建有图标的网站导航菜单
以图例方式介绍CSS制作网页详细步骤
推荐43个XHTML+CSS网页及导航布局实例教程
制作网页过程种需要学习的CSS教程
学习CSS的人值得去的6个CSS资源站
Webjx推荐20个关于CSS3优秀学习资源
import与link的具体区别
CSS设计制作网页不要使用@import
网页收集的优秀的CSS技巧与教程
CSS实例教程:弹性+固宽布局
网页CSS优化使网页具有语义化
Webjx推荐30个网站导航使用CSS的最佳方式
总结:CSS样式表的技术优势和功能
格式化CSS和精简CSS的在线CSS优化工具

CSS样式表 中的 IE6支持position:fixed完美解决方法


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-10-12   浏览: 134 ::
收藏到网摘: n/a

IE7已经支持position:fixed了,而我们的IE6呢?还继续使用js事件?消耗资源,破坏结构,画面闪耀。 今天去一老外站看到了这他站上的十分平滑但却没有js,好奇,原来。。巧妙啊,分享下,相对而言比较节省资源。但效果好,使用方便,兼顾w3c。哈哈
复制代码 代码如下:

<!-- compliance patch for microsoft browsers -->
<!--[if lt IE 7]><link rel="stylesheet" href="ie-stuff.css" type="text/css" media="screen"/><![endif]-->

ie-stuff.css
复制代码 代码如下:

#footer {
position: absolute;
bottom: auto;
clear: both;
top:e­xpression(eval(document.compatMode &&
document.compatMode=='CSS1Compat') ?
documentElement.scrollTop
+(documentElement.clientHeight-this.clientHeight) - 1
: document.body.scrollTop
+(document.body.clientHeight-this.clientHeight) - 1);
}